Positions Available for a Range of Skill Levels

We are hiring for both standard electrical testing roles and more advanced troubleshooting positions, with pay determined by your background and technical experience.

Typical daily duties
  • Testing, troubleshooting, repairing, and overhauling electronic products
  • Recording and documenting electrical test data
  • Calibrating and maintaining test equipment
This role is an excellent fit if you
  • Have strong attention to detail and above‑average English reading skills
  • Are comfortable using computers and basic hand tools
  • Enjoy solving problems and learning new technical skills
  • Have experience troubleshooting electronics at the component level – OR – Are working toward or recently completed an electrical or mechanical engineering degree and want hands‑on technical experience
